From e6044634dd7caec2d79a13aecc9e765023768757 Mon Sep 17 00:00:00 2001 From: Phoebe Liang Date: Wed, 2 Nov 2022 15:27:54 -0700 Subject: Support logging of user-defined types that implement `AbslStringify()` If a user-defined type has `AbslStringify()` defined, it will always be used for logging over `operator<<`. `HasAbslStringify` now uses the empty class `UnimplementedSink` for its checks instead of `StringifySink` in order to make it work in cases involving other sinks.
